To all branch managers,

Negotiations with our landlord, Stonehatch Properties, regarding the Corvette Row warehouse lease have entered their final stage. We expect a revised term of five years with a rent reduction of roughly 9%, in exchange for taking on minor maintenance obligations. No branch relocations are planned at this time, but managers should defer any long-term storage commitments until the agreement is signed. Final terms will circulate once countersigned. The underlying reason we are pressing for flexibility is stated below.

internal memo for hafog-hadug: The pricing group signed off on a budget of $16.1 million for Project Gorir. The renewal with Oliionax Systems closes at $14.1 million a year, 46 percent above the last contract.

**Q: What does the kiosk watchdog actually enforce?**

The Pendlebox kiosk app runs a watchdog that expects a heartbeat from the UI thread every 15 seconds. Two missed beats: soft restart of the renderer. Five: full device reboot. Reviewers should check that any long-running work added to the UI thread is moved off it, or the watchdog will cycle the kiosk in the field. Heartbeat interval and thresholds are config-driven; don't hardcode them. Escalation thresholds and tuning history are documented on the internal page below.

operations page: https://jira.qorvellabs.internal/projects/pages/projects/projects/68aa

## Runbook: Zero-downtime schema migrations (Cobblefin stack)

Support folks, quick refresher before you escalate anything: all Cobblefin migrations are expand-contract. We add new columns first, dual-write for a release, then drop the old ones — so you should never see a hard cutover. If a customer reports errors mid-migration, check the `migration_ledger` table for a stuck phase before paging anyone. Rollback is just flipping the phase marker back. To inspect the ledger directly, connect with the string below.

replica DSN, kajep-yahag: mssql://praok_svc:iF@db-8d68.plorvaio.local:5432/eliion